1 #include "cache.h"
2 #include "config.h"
3 #include "strbuf.h"
4 #include "run-command.h"
5 #include "sigchain.h"
6
7 #ifndef DEFAULT_EDITOR
8 #define DEFAULT_EDITOR "vi"
9 #endif
10
11 int is_terminal_dumb(void)
12 {
13 const char *terminal = getenv("TERM");
14 return !terminal || !strcmp(terminal, "dumb");
15 }
16
17 const char *git_editor(void)
18 {
19 const char *editor = getenv("GIT_EDITOR");
20 int terminal_is_dumb = is_terminal_dumb();
21
22 if (!editor && editor_program)
23 editor = editor_program;
24 if (!editor && !terminal_is_dumb)
25 editor = getenv("VISUAL");
26 if (!editor)
27 editor = getenv("EDITOR");
28
29 if (!editor && terminal_is_dumb)
30 return NULL;
31
32 if (!editor)
33 editor = DEFAULT_EDITOR;
34
35 return editor;
36 }
37
38 const char *git_sequence_editor(void)
39 {
40 const char *editor = getenv("GIT_SEQUENCE_EDITOR");
41
42 if (!editor)
43 git_config_get_string_const("sequence.editor", &editor);
44 if (!editor)
45 editor = git_editor();
46
47 return editor;
48 }
49
50 static int launch_specified_editor(const char *editor, const char *path,
51 struct strbuf *buffer, const char *const *env)
52 {
53 if (!editor)
54 return error("Terminal is dumb, but EDITOR unset");
55
56 if (strcmp(editor, ":")) {
57 const char *args[] = { editor, real_path(path), NULL };
58 struct child_process p = CHILD_PROCESS_INIT;
59 int ret, sig;
60 int print_waiting_for_editor = advice_waiting_for_editor && isatty(2);
61
62 if (print_waiting_for_editor) {
63 /*
64 * A dumb terminal cannot erase the line later on. Add a
65 * newline to separate the hint from subsequent output.
66 *
67 * Make sure that our message is separated with a whitespace
68 * from further cruft that may be written by the editor.
69 */
70 const char term = is_terminal_dumb() ? '\n' : ' ';
71
72 fprintf(stderr,
73 _("hint: Waiting for your editor to close the file...%c"),
74 term);
75 fflush(stderr);
76 }
77
78 p.argv = args;
79 p.env = env;
80 p.use_shell = 1;
81 p.trace2_child_class = "editor";
82 if (start_command(&p) < 0)
83 return error("unable to start editor '%s'", editor);
84
85 sigchain_push(SIGINT, SIG_IGN);
86 sigchain_push(SIGQUIT, SIG_IGN);
87 ret = finish_command(&p);
88 sig = ret - 128;
89 sigchain_pop(SIGINT);
90 sigchain_pop(SIGQUIT);
91 if (sig == SIGINT || sig == SIGQUIT)
92 raise(sig);
93 if (ret)
94 return error("There was a problem with the editor '%s'.",
95 editor);
96
97 if (print_waiting_for_editor && !is_terminal_dumb())
98 /*
99 * Erase the entire line to avoid wasting the
100 * vertical space.
101 */
102 term_clear_line();
103 }
104
105 if (!buffer)
106 return 0;
107 if (strbuf_read_file(buffer, path, 0) < 0)
108 return error_errno("could not read file '%s'", path);
109 return 0;
110 }
111
112 int launch_editor(const char *path, struct strbuf *buffer, const char *const *env)
113 {
114 return launch_specified_editor(git_editor(), path, buffer, env);
115 }
116
117 int launch_sequence_editor(const char *path, struct strbuf *buffer,
118 const char *const *env)
119 {
120 return launch_specified_editor(git_sequence_editor(), path, buffer, env);
121 }
